Transaction 591a85c87b8ec1576c9724a635793b0d9288bdbce010f0a80d924ca95b34a0f9

1 Input
2 Outputs
  • 591a85c87b8ec1576c9724a635793b0d9288bdbce010f0a80d924ca95b34a0f9:0
  • value  11488256
    address  1Cja9szjFykJpFk57EGGqBYz7XHVZ1WtH
  • 591a85c87b8ec1576c9724a635793b0d9288bdbce010f0a80d924ca95b34a0f9:1
  • value  271952971
    address  339wkLNKKwfcGXKK7e4Ka48ebXHvSFckgk